Php 以特定格式将1000万条mysql记录迁移到MongoDB的策略

Php 以特定格式将1000万条mysql记录迁移到MongoDB的策略,php,mysql,mongodb,database-migration,Php,Mysql,Mongodb,Database Migration,我有1000万条MySQL记录,我希望以某种方式存储这些记录,以便基于月份和日期的过滤器能够正常工作 在Mysql中,我有各种各样的表,数据通过不同的连接进行关联,以收集用户的登录活动,其中用户可以是不同的类型/角色 Mongo Collection应该以某种方式拥有数据,这样我们就可以轻松地获取数据,而不必考虑Mysql连接,在我们当前的场景中,Mysql连接有点繁重 假设我在MongoDB中有以下数据集 example - date count role filte

我有1000万条MySQL记录,我希望以某种方式存储这些记录,以便基于月份和日期的过滤器能够正常工作

在Mysql中,我有各种各样的表,数据通过不同的连接进行关联,以收集用户的登录活动,其中用户可以是不同的类型/角色

Mongo Collection应该以某种方式拥有数据,这样我们就可以轻松地获取数据,而不必考虑Mysql连接,在我们当前的场景中,Mysql连接有点繁重

假设我在MongoDB中有以下数据集

example -  date         count  role    filter
           2020-01-01   100    admin   total
           2020-01-01   200    staff   total
           2020-01-01   35     admin   unique


尝试添加您尝试过的内容。从关系模型直接迁移到文档模型将需要认真重新考虑您的架构和查询模式。我的计数永远不会改变请提供任何建议